The Birth of an Automotive Legend

The original Range Rover, introduced by Land Rover in 1970, was a revolutionary concept. It combined serious off-road capabilities with unprecedented comfort — a rare combination at the time. The model’s boxy design, permanent four-wheel drive, and long-travel suspension quickly became hallmarks of the brand.

Through the 55 years of Range Rover, the company has stayed true to this philosophy. It has continuously pushed boundaries, turning a once utilitarian vehicle into a luxury masterpiece. Each model introduced cutting-edge features — from air suspension in the 1990s to advanced infotainment and hybrid powertrains in the 2020s.

55 Years of Range Rover: The Evolution of Design

Design has always played a central role in the Range Rover story. The original model’s minimalist aesthetic has evolved into a sleek, modern design language that emphasizes refinement. Through 55 years of Range Rover, every generation has maintained the same design DNA — floating roof, clamshell bonnet, and clean body lines — while embracing modern trends.

The latest fifth-generation Range Rover embodies “reductive design,” a philosophy that focuses on simplicity and elegance. Its flush door handles, hidden details, and sculpted surfaces make it instantly recognizable while maintaining the timeless Range Rover identity.

Off-Road Royalty — 55 Years of Unmatched Capability

One of the reasons Range Rover has stood strong for 55 years is its unmatched off-road performance. Despite its luxury status, it remains one of the most capable SUVs on the planet. Features like adjustable air suspension, Terrain Response 2, and all-wheel steering ensure it can conquer mud, snow, sand, and rock with ease.

Even in its modern electric and hybrid versions, Range Rover continues to deliver legendary capability. The brand’s commitment to adventure and exploration is as strong today as it was five decades ago — a core reason it continues to dominate the global luxury SUV market.

Sustainability and the Future Beyond 55 Years of Range Rover

As the automotive world moves toward sustainability, Range Rover is leading the way. The next chapter after 55 years of Range Rover focuses on cleaner, smarter, and more responsible innovation. The brand’s future lineup includes fully electric Range Rovers, set to launch soon, combining zero-emission technology with the same iconic performance and comfort.

This transition reflects Land Rover’s broader “Reimagine” strategy — a vision that aims to achieve net-zero carbon emissions by 2039. It’s proof that even after 55 years, Range Rover continues to evolve with the times, adapting without losing its identity.
